Consider the following 3 x 4 contingency table in which a sample of 1400 companies is summarized in terms of the company’s industry type (X, Y, or Z) and geographic location (A, B, C, or D). A B C D X 124 110 108 114 Y 130 106 122 112 Z 128 118 112 116 What is the probability P(B│Y)? 0.0757 0.2255 0.4985 0.2485 0.3174
